    Population


    The most recent population of Fayetteville is 22,909 people. The average population from 2011 to 2019 was 19,994. The large population increase was 1,237 people, and it occurred in 2013. The largest population decrease was 259 people, and it occurred in 2016. Since 2011, the population has changed by 1,823.00. The average population change for Fayetteville was 7.84%. .

    Gender Segmentation


    47.68% (10347 individuals) of the population is male while 52.32% (11353 individuals) of the population is female.

    Poverty Segmentation


    $13.07% of the population in zip code 37334 are poor. Compare this to the state poor percentage of $12.79%.
